Is one finger width Diastasis Recti?
Dealing with Diastasis
While some separation of the rectus abdominis (6-pack) muscles is the norm during pregnancy to make way for an expanding belly, the separation often closes back up as you heal from delivery. It's also totally normal to have 1-2 fingers' width separation even after healing.

Will insurance cover Diastasis Recti?
Many women suffer from diastasis recti after pregnancy. It is a muscular surgical repair that is almost never covered by insurance for women, though it is often covered for men.

Is Diastasis Recti a hernia?
Diastasis recti is a common clinical condition and is frequently confused with hernia. The two are distinctly different and, thus, require different treatments. The term diastasis means a separation of two parts.
